Ciswerk Cermet Metal Cutting Circular Saws
For low and medium carbon steel bar, tube and profile cutting.
- OD 250-840 mm
- Kerf 2.0-4.0 mm
- Bore 32 / 40 / 50 / 80 mm
- V 100-130 m/min, Sz 0.05-0.10 mm
Ciswerk Coated Cermet Cold Saw Blades
For medium and high carbon steel with longer blade life.
- OD 250-840 mm
- Kerf 2.0-4.0 mm
- Teeth 40-140
- V 90-130 m/min, Sz 0.05-0.10 mm
Ciswerk TCT Coated Cold Saw Blades
For 201, 304 and 316 stainless steel cutting.
- OD 250-840 mm
- Kerf 2.0-4.0 mm
- Bore 32 / 40 / 50 / 80 mm
- V 50-70 m/min, Sz 0.035-0.05 mm
